Project Scope and Duration

Short-Term Projects

If your project is short-term, hiring a dump truck hauling service can be more efficient. This option eliminates the hassle of arranging for a truck, training operators, and managing maintenance. The service provider handles all logistics, allowing you to focus on the core aspects of your project.

Long-Term Projects

For long-term projects, renting might be more cost-effective. Although you take on the responsibility of managing the truck, you gain flexibility in using it as needed without being bound by service schedules. However, consider the costs of hiring a skilled operator if you lack one.

Budget Considerations

Cost is often a deciding factor. Hiring a dump truck service can be more expensive upfront, but it includes the cost of fuel, maintenance, and experienced drivers. Renting a truck requires you to cover these additional expenses, potentially leading to unforeseen costs.

It's crucial to evaluate your budget and determine which option aligns with your financial constraints. For smaller budgets, hiring might provide a clearer picture of total expenses, helping to avoid unexpected financial strain.

Expertise and Equipment

Access to Skilled Operators

When you hire a dump truck hauling service, you gain access to skilled operators who can handle complex tasks efficiently. This expertise can be invaluable, especially for intricate projects requiring precision and experience.

Equipment Availability

Renting offers you the opportunity to choose specific equipment tailored to your needs. However, availability can sometimes be a challenge, especially during peak seasons. Hiring a service ensures you have the right equipment on time without the stress of searching for rentals.

Environmental and Safety Concerns

Dump truck service providers are often well-versed in environmental regulations and safety protocols, ensuring that your project complies with local laws. This can prevent potential legal issues and fines associated with improper waste disposal or safety violations.

On the other hand, renting a truck requires you to familiarize yourself with these regulations and ensure compliance, which can be time-consuming and complex.
